The Karnataka government’s Shakti scheme, aimed at providing women with free bus travel, has come under scrutiny for alleged misuse by KSRTC conductors. Reports indicate that conductors have been issuing free tickets meant for women to male passengers after collecting full fares.

A group of engineering students traveling from Bedarapura to Chamarajanagar recently raised concerns. They reported that, despite paying their fares, the conductor issued free tickets under the Shakti scheme. When questioned, the conductor claimed he was giving free tickets to other male passengers as well.

Disturbed by this misuse, the students filed a complaint with the traffic controller in Chamarajanagar, calling for strict action and accountability.
